Output 322f025828e9a7edb15166b1410f589e9c138dc557e217ac4b0a50d90329d7b7:13

value
63899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97cce05f81775f3c95b49e8e30e12c78face4dd2 OP_EQUAL
address
3FXfPaMmy8XgwYz3PESNGdzjMuiY6aVb3x
transaction
322f025828e9a7edb15166b1410f589e9c138dc557e217ac4b0a50d90329d7b7
confirmations
574
spent
true